Subject: Config service key rotated — action required

New team members, read this fully. The Quillhaven config service key rotated today. Hot-reload means your services pick up config changes without restarts, but only if the watcher authenticates successfully; a bad key fails silently and you keep serving stale values. Update your local env file, restart the watcher once, and confirm the reload timestamp advances. Old keys stop working at end of day. The replacement key follows on the next line.

gateway credential: kto23_LX9A4ys6i4nzHtpOLNLodKK

**On-call Note: GraphQL N+1 Fix (Fernhollow API)**

The resolver for `orderLines` previously issued one query per parent order; the batching loader introduced in release 41 collapses these into a single fetch. If latency alerts fire on that path, first confirm the loader cache is enabled via the diagnostics endpoint. Authenticate your diagnostics calls against the internal gateway with the key below.

API key for yahig-tadup: kto7_ubizbYm

## TICKET-2241: Report exports stamped in wrong timezone

Hey folks — new joiners hit this a lot. Exports from the Pellmarsh reporting job were coming out in UTC even though tenants expect local time. Turns out the staging box was missing half its env config, so the exporter fell back to defaults. We've fixed the TZ var, but while you're in there, note the exporter also won't talk to the archive service without its access credential set. To finish the fix, add this line to exporter.env:

vault entry, yajop-bafop: ARCHIVE_KEY3=8d4

- [ ] Before the Quillhaven signing ceremony proceeds, run the leaked-file-descriptor hunt on the offline signer. As a new contractor, please be thorough: enumerate every open descriptor on the sealed host, confirm nothing points at the ceremony scratch volume, and log each finding in the Larkspur register. If any descriptor traces back to the retired Fenwick exporter, halt and page the ceremony lead. Once the host shows a clean descriptor table, unlock the escrow envelope using the phrase below.

unlock words, yajof-tagef: aldiel-kasath-briax-fraeth-pelius-olieth-pelix-wenius-wenael-norael